Guttman SIGNATURE, ITEM SUMMARY: Technology Boulevard Resurfacing Project (Project) between Fabyan Parkway and Roosevelt Road (IL-38) is targeted for a March 10, 2023, Illinois Department of Transportation (IDOT) letting with construction anticipated to begin in the summer of 2023. The project is federally funded through the region’s Surface Transportation Program (STP), administered by IDOT, with matching local funds from the City’s Motor Fuel Tax (MFT) Fund. The estimated construction cost for the Project is $1,008,455.89. The City received 80% federal funds or an amount not to exceed $887,441 for both Construction and Construction Engineering (CE). To use federal funds, CE is required to ensure that the Project is completed and documented in accordance with IDOT-approved plans, specifications, and policies. Furthermore, CE services are required and selected through a process known as Qualifications Based Selection (QBS). This process is mandatory for all projects in which federal funds are used for CE with a value of $40,000 or greater. A Most Qualified Firm (MQF) is selected based on the QBS evaluation process. In October 2022, a public notice was advertised seeking a Statement of Interest (SOl) from qualified engineering firms for CE services. After a three-week advertising period, six SOls were evaluated in November 2022. Two personnel from the City staff and an Assistant Director of Public Works from another municipality evaluated the SOls. HRG’s scope of work will include Project start-up, construction observation and administration, construction layout, project coordination with the City, contractor, businesses as well as other stakeholders, and closeout. Material testing is also included in the proposed agreement, which will be completed by HRG’s sub-consultant Rubino Engineering, Inc. The FY 2023 Proposed Budget includes $100,900 under the Motor Fuel Tax Fund (16-34-58-4807) for CE services. HRG’s original proposed scope and service fees were $98,664. After successful negotiations, HRG was able to reduce its proposed fees by $9,649 or 9.8% to a proposed agreement amount not to exceed $89,018.00. Typically, engineering service fees on construction projects range from 10% to 15% of the construction cost. HR Green’s proposed CE agreement amount is 8.8% of the estimated Project construction cost of $1,008,455.89.
